How Big is a Million?
Pipkin the smallest penguin is always asking questions, but what he wants to know most of all is how big is a million? This picture book helps children understand the concept of big numbers. It also includes a fold-out poster that shows Pipkin looking at the sky, printed with exactly one million stars.
How Big is a Million? is a delightful story that explores the concept of large numbers through the eyes of Pipkin, a curious little penguin with a big heart.
Pipkin is on a quest to understand exactly how big a million is. This whimsical tale takes young readers on a journey filled with gentle humour and unforgettable characters, making big numbers more relatable.
Adding to the magic, the book features a special 1 x 1.5m fold-out poster at the end, illustrating Pipkin gazing at the sky. The poster is adorned with precisely one million stars, offering a tangible representation of the vast number.
Perfectly complemented with charming illustrations, How Big is a Million? is both educational and entertaining, sparking curiosity and wonder in children and adults alike.

About the Author
Growing up on the Wirral and in Germany, Anna wrote plays about talking animals, and stories about naughty children, and drew on every available surface. After school, she did an Art Foundation course, then a degree in German Literature & Philosophy at Oxford University. In 1998 she found her perfect job at Usborne in London, writing about everything from curious penguins to trips to the Moon.
